What Kind of Gas Line Problems Can We Fix?
Not all gas line issues are obvious—but all of them are serious. That’s why our team follows a strict checklist on every repair call.
We locate leaks, test pressure levels, and check your gas lines for:
- Physical damage or stress from shifting soil
- Rust, corrosion, or aging joints
- Improper installations or poor sealing
- Loose appliance hookups or cracked fittings
Using modern gas detection equipment, we pinpoint the problem and repair it right the first time. We don’t guess, and we don’t leave safety to chance.

We start with a full inspection and written estimate. No surprises. Once approved, we shut off service safely, make the necessary repairs, and perform pressure testing before turning anything back on. We don’t take shortcuts—because your safety is on the line.
Whether it’s underground piping to a firepit or interior lines to your range or furnace, we repair it with the precision and care it deserves. And if you need permits, we’ll pull them. If inspections are required, we’ll schedule and pass them.

Frequently Asked Questions
What should I do if I smell gas in my home?
Leave the area immediately. Don’t use electronics or turn on lights. Call your gas provider or 911, then call us once the area is safe.
Can you repair both indoor and outdoor gas lines?
Yes—we service gas lines to appliances, water heaters, fireplaces, outdoor kitchens, and more.
Do I need a permit for gas line repair in Lake Oswego?
Most gas line repairs do require a permit. Don’t worry—we handle all permitting and inspection requirements.
How do I know if my gas line needs repair?
Signs include a rotten egg smell, hissing sounds, visible corrosion, or appliances not lighting properly.
